Introduction: The Quest for Leaner Windows

Windows 11, Microsoft’s latest operating system, brought a visual overhaul, performance improvements, and new features. However, it also came with stricter hardware requirements and a larger footprint than its predecessors. This has led many users, particularly those with older hardware, limited storage space, or a preference for a minimalist computing experience, to seek out “Windows 11 Lite.”

It’s crucial to understand that Microsoft does not officially offer a product called “Windows 11 Lite.” The term is an umbrella descriptor for various modified versions of Windows 11 that have been stripped down, tweaked, or otherwise altered to reduce resource usage, remove unwanted components, and improve performance on less powerful hardware. These modifications are typically created by third-party developers and enthusiasts, not by Microsoft.

Understanding the “Lite” Concept

The core idea behind “Windows 11 Lite” is to create a leaner, faster, and more efficient version of the operating system. This is typically achieved by:

  • Removing Bloatware: Pre-installed applications, trial software, and optional features that many users don’t need are eliminated. This includes things like Candy Crush, Xbox Game Bar components (if not gaming), Cortana, and various Microsoft Store apps.
  • Disabling Services: Many background services run constantly, consuming resources. “Lite” versions often disable non-essential services to free up RAM and CPU cycles.
  • Tweaking Registry Settings: The Windows Registry contains countless settings that control system behavior. “Lite” versions may modify these settings to optimize performance, disable telemetry (data collection), and change visual effects.
  • Removing Features: Some Windows 11 features, like Hyper-V (virtualization), Windows Subsystem for Linux (WSL), or even Windows Defender (antivirus), might be removed entirely in more extreme “Lite” versions.
  • Bypassing Hardware Requirements: A key aspect of many “Lite” builds is the removal or circumvention of Windows 11’s strict hardware checks, particularly the TPM 2.0 and Secure Boot requirements. This allows installation on older, unsupported PCs.

Motivations for Using Windows 11 Lite

Users are drawn to “Windows 11 Lite” for a variety of reasons:

  • Older Hardware Compatibility: The primary motivation is often to run Windows 11 on computers that don’t meet the official minimum system requirements. This allows users to experience the new interface and some features without needing to upgrade their hardware.
  • Improved Performance: By removing unnecessary components and services, “Lite” versions can significantly boost performance, especially on low-end systems. Boot times are faster, applications launch quicker, and overall responsiveness is improved.
  • Reduced Storage Footprint: The smaller size of a “Lite” installation saves valuable disk space, which is particularly beneficial for devices with limited storage, such as low-cost laptops or tablets.
  • Enhanced Privacy: Some “Lite” builds focus on reducing or eliminating telemetry and data collection by Microsoft, appealing to privacy-conscious users.
  • Minimalist Experience: Some users simply prefer a cleaner, less cluttered operating system without the pre-installed apps and features they don’t use.
  • Gaming Optimization: Gamers may use “Lite” versions to dedicate as much system resources as possible to games, minimizing background processes that could impact performance.
  • Virtual Machine Use: “Lite” builds are ideal for running in virtual machines, as they consume fewer host resources.

Methods for Achieving a “Lighter” Windows 11

There are several approaches to creating or obtaining a “Windows 11 Lite” experience, ranging from simple tweaks to using heavily modified installation images:

  1. Manual Debloating and Tweaking (Safest):

    • Uninstalling Unwanted Apps: The most basic step is to manually uninstall pre-installed apps through the “Apps & features” section in Settings.
    • Disabling Startup Programs: Use Task Manager (Startup tab) to disable programs that automatically launch at startup, freeing up resources.
    • Adjusting Visual Effects: In System Properties (Advanced system settings > Performance > Settings), you can choose to adjust visual effects for best performance.
    • Disabling Services (Carefully): Use the Services application (services.msc) to disable non-essential services. This requires careful research, as disabling the wrong service can break system functionality. Black Viper’s service configurations (blackviper.com) are a popular resource, but always understand the implications before disabling a service.
    • Using PowerShell Scripts: PowerShell scripts can automate the removal of apps and features. Many scripts are available online, but exercise extreme caution and review the script’s code before running it.
    • Registry Edits (Advanced): Experienced users can modify the Windows Registry to tweak performance and disable features. Incorrect registry edits can severely damage your system, so back up the registry before making any changes.
    • Using Third Party Debloating Tools: There are programs made by third party developers such as Bloatynosy, O&O Shutup11++ and ThisIsWin11. These can be used to tweak your Windows 11 system and reduce pre-installed software.
  2. Using a Custom Installation Script (Moderate Risk):

    • MSMG Toolkit: This powerful tool allows you to customize a Windows 11 ISO image by removing components, integrating updates, and applying tweaks. It requires significant technical knowledge and careful configuration.
    • NTLite: Another popular tool for customizing Windows installation images. It offers a more user-friendly interface than MSMG Toolkit but still requires understanding of Windows components.
    • Other Script-Based Solutions: Various scripts and tools are available online, often shared on forums and communities dedicated to Windows customization. Thoroughly research and vet any script before using it.
  3. Downloading a Pre-built “Lite” ISO (Highest Risk):

    • Various Sources: Pre-built “Windows 11 Lite” ISO images are available from various online sources, often on forums, torrent sites, and file-sharing platforms. These are the riskiest option, as you have no control over the modifications made and there’s a high potential for malware or instability.
    • Unknown Modifications: You typically don’t know exactly what changes have been made to the ISO, which services have been disabled, or what registry settings have been altered.
    • Potential for Malware: Downloaded ISOs from untrusted sources can contain malware, viruses, or backdoors that compromise your system’s security.
    • Instability and Bugs: Heavily modified ISOs can be unstable, leading to crashes, errors, and compatibility issues with software and hardware.

Drawbacks and Risks of Using Windows 11 Lite

The potential benefits of “Windows 11 Lite” come with significant drawbacks and risks, especially when using pre-built ISOs from untrusted sources:

  • Security Risks (Major Concern):

    • Malware: Downloaded ISOs can be infected with malware, viruses, keyloggers, or backdoors, putting your data and privacy at serious risk.
    • Disabled Security Features: Some “Lite” builds disable or remove security features like Windows Defender, leaving your system vulnerable to threats.
    • Lack of Updates: Modified ISOs might not receive security updates from Microsoft, leaving your system exposed to known vulnerabilities.
  • Instability and Compatibility Issues:

    • System Crashes: Heavily modified systems can be unstable, leading to frequent crashes and errors.
    • Software Incompatibility: Some applications may not function correctly if essential system components or services have been removed.
    • Hardware Driver Issues: Driver compatibility can be affected, leading to problems with peripherals or hardware components.
  • Lack of Support:

    • No Microsoft Support: Microsoft does not support modified versions of Windows. If you encounter problems, you’re on your own.
    • Limited Community Support: While online communities may offer some assistance, support for heavily modified builds is often limited.
  • Ethical and Legal Considerations:

    • Violation of Terms of Service: Modifying the Windows ISO image may violate Microsoft’s terms of service.
    • Piracy Concerns: Downloading pre-built ISOs from unofficial sources often involves copyright infringement.
    • Activation Issues: “Lite” versions may use questionable activation methods that could be blocked by Microsoft.
  • Feature Loss: You may lose access to features you actually need or want. Carefully consider which features are essential before removing them.

  • Time and Effort: Creating your own “Lite” version using tools like MSMG Toolkit or NTLite requires significant time, technical knowledge, and careful planning.

Specific Examples of “Lite” Techniques and Tools

Let’s delve into some specific examples of techniques and tools used to create “Windows 11 Lite” experiences:

  • Bloatynosy: This is a popular, relatively safe, and open-source tool that provides a user-friendly interface for debloating Windows 11. It allows you to uninstall pre-installed apps, disable features, and apply various tweaks. It’s a good starting point for users who want to manually debloat without resorting to scripts or ISO modifications.

  • O&O ShutUp11++: Another reputable tool focused on privacy and security. It allows you to disable telemetry, tracking features, and other privacy-invasive settings in Windows 11. It’s generally considered safe to use.

  • ThisIsWin11: This open-source tool offers a wide range of customization options, including debloating, privacy tweaks, and UI modifications. It’s more powerful than Bloatynosy but also requires more careful consideration of the changes you’re making.

  • PowerShell Scripts (Example – Chris Titus Tech’s Script): Many PowerShell scripts are available online that automate the debloating process. Chris Titus Tech’s Windows Utility is a well-known example. However, it’s crucial to understand the script’s code before running it. These scripts often remove apps, disable services, and modify registry settings. Always back up your system before running any script. A typical script might include commands like:

  • MSMG Toolkit (Advanced): This tool allows you to create a highly customized Windows 11 ISO image. You can remove components, integrate updates, add drivers, and apply various tweaks. It’s a powerful tool but requires significant technical expertise. The process typically involves:

    1. Mounting the Windows 11 ISO: Extract the contents of the original Windows 11 ISO image.
    2. Using MSMG Toolkit’s Interface: Select the components you want to remove (e.g., Windows Media Player, Internet Explorer, specific Windows features).
    3. Integrating Updates: Download and integrate the latest Windows updates.
    4. Adding Drivers: Integrate drivers for your specific hardware.
    5. Applying Tweaks: Modify registry settings and apply other optimizations.
    6. Creating a New ISO: Build a new, customized ISO image.
  • NTLite (Advanced): Similar to MSMG Toolkit, NTLite allows you to customize Windows installation images. It has a more user-friendly interface than MSMG Toolkit, making it slightly more accessible, but still requires a good understanding of Windows components. The process is similar to MSMG Toolkit: mounting the ISO, removing components, integrating updates, adding drivers, and creating a new ISO.

  • Tiny11/Tiny11 Builder: This is a specific example of a pre-built “Lite” project that has gained some popularity. It aims to create a very small and lightweight version of Windows 11. However, it falls under the category of pre-built ISOs, so all the warnings about security, stability, and legality apply. Tiny11 Builder is the script used to create Tiny11, which is a more safe method of obtaining Tiny11.

Alternatives to Heavily Modified ISOs

If you’re concerned about the risks associated with heavily modified ISOs (and you should be), there are safer alternatives to achieve a leaner Windows 11 experience:

  • Manual Debloating and Tweaking (Recommended): This is the safest and most recommended approach. Use the methods described earlier (uninstalling apps, disabling startup programs, adjusting visual effects, carefully disabling services) to customize your installation without compromising security or stability.
  • Windows 11 “N” Editions (Europe): In Europe, Microsoft offers “N” editions of Windows 11 that don’t include media-related technologies (Windows Media Player, etc.) due to antitrust regulations. These editions are slightly smaller and can be a good starting point for further customization. However, they are primarily intended for the European market.
  • Windows 11 SE (Education): Windows 11 SE is a cloud-first edition designed for educational institutions. It’s a simplified version of Windows 11 with a focus on essential apps and features for students. It is not available for general consumers.
  • Virtual Machines: If you want to experiment with a heavily modified “Lite” version, do so within a virtual machine. This isolates the modified system from your main operating system, reducing the risk of damage or data loss.

Legal and Licensing Aspects

The legal and licensing aspects of “Windows 11 Lite” are complex and often in a gray area:

  • Microsoft’s Terms of Service: Modifying the Windows ISO image may violate Microsoft’s terms of service. However, the extent to which Microsoft enforces this is unclear.
  • Copyright Infringement: Distributing modified ISO images without Microsoft’s permission is generally considered copyright infringement.
  • Activation: You still need a valid Windows 11 license to activate your “Lite” installation. Using KMS activators or other illegitimate activation methods is illegal and can lead to your activation being blocked.
  • “N” Editions: The “N” editions are fully licensed and supported by Microsoft, as long as you purchase a legitimate license.

Creating Your Own Minimally Customized Windows 11 Installation (Advanced Users)

This section provides a high-level overview of the steps involved in creating your own minimally customized Windows 11 installation using tools like NTLite. This is for advanced users who understand the risks and are comfortable working with system files. Always back up your system before making any modifications.

  1. Obtain a Legitimate Windows 11 ISO: Download the official Windows 11 ISO image from Microsoft’s website.

  2. Install NTLite: Download and install NTLite (or MSMG Toolkit, if you prefer).

  3. Mount the ISO: In NTLite, load the Windows 11 ISO image. This will extract the contents and make them accessible for modification.

  4. Remove Components (Carefully):

    • Go to the “Components” section in NTLite.
    • Carefully select the components you want to remove. Start with obvious bloatware like pre-installed apps, Cortana (if you don’t use it), and optional features you don’t need.
    • Avoid removing core system components unless you are absolutely sure you know what you’re doing.
    • Research each component before removing it to understand its function and potential impact.
  5. Integrate Updates (Optional):

    • Go to the “Updates” section.
    • Download the latest Windows 11 updates.
    • NTLite will integrate these updates into the installation image.
  6. Add Drivers (Optional):

    • Go to the “Drivers” section.
    • Add drivers for your specific hardware, especially if you have older or uncommon devices.
  7. Apply Tweaks (Advanced):

    • NTLite allows you to modify registry settings and apply various performance tweaks.
    • Exercise extreme caution with registry edits. Back up the registry before making any changes.
    • Research any tweaks you apply to understand their potential impact.
  8. Create the ISO:

    • Go to the “Apply” section.
    • Select “Create ISO” to build a new, customized ISO image.
  9. Test in a Virtual Machine (Highly Recommended):

    • Before installing the customized ISO on your physical computer, test it thoroughly in a virtual machine (e.g., VirtualBox, VMware).
    • This allows you to identify any potential issues or incompatibilities without risking your main system.
  10. Install on Physical Hardware (If Testing is Successful):

    • If the virtual machine testing is successful, you can create a bootable USB drive from the customized ISO and install it on your physical computer.
    • Be prepared to troubleshoot any issues that may arise.
